Transaction 72f8d05081e8d17d0642c18890f411643233c3cc4824d6ac953290e3df560990

1 Input
1 Outputs
  • 72f8d05081e8d17d0642c18890f411643233c3cc4824d6ac953290e3df560990:0
  • value  1006837088
    address  3Kg2JcNnBczmHSX3udTfrKdqDy1gkrVZak